Invesco Advantage Municipal Income Trust II (the Trust) is a closed-end management investment company. The Trust’s investment objective is to provide current income which is exempt from federal income tax. The Trust seeks to provide a high level of tax-free income by purchasing bonds that are exempt from federal personal income taxes and employing higher leverage levels than other investment vehicles. The Trust invests in inverse floating rate securities, such as tender option bonds (TOBs), for investment purposes and to enhance the yield of the Trust. In addition, the Trust intends to invest in such municipal securities to allow it to qualify to pay shareholders-exempt dividends. The Trust may invest in securities that are subject to interest rate risk. The Trust invests in sectors, including hospitals, dedicated tax, airports, IDR/PCR, and others. The Trust’s investment adviser is Invesco Advisers, Inc.
